THE STUDIO
Carbonated is a games studio founded in 2015 by industry veterans who’ve built and run some of the biggest games in the world at companies like EA, Sony, Zynga and Blizzard. We’re aspiring to be a company where people want to spend their entire careers. Today we’re fortunate enough to be working on our own mobile game called MadWorld (a real-time multiplayer game set in a dystopian world).

WHAT YOU’LL DO
- Grow the community: leverage your skills to work with the leadership team to grow and engage players and build a thriving community
- Plan and execute community campaigns: game videos, interviews, dev updates, polls, memes, live streams and anything our audience might be interested in
- Be the Community Voice: report on key metrics and aggregate feedback to make sure the dev team knows what the players are thinking
- Dev team interface: As a player-first studio, engage with the dev team to ensure players' voices are heard and integrated into the dev roadmap
- Social innovator: Stay up-to-date on latest trends and channels to grow and engage our community
WHAT’S REQUIRED
- Experience growing communities to thousands of active players
- Proven ability to create engaging content (by leveraging studio assets)
- You have strong image, audio & video editing skills (Photoshop, FCP, AE)
- Experience managing multiple mods, community leaders and streamers
- Ability to work and interface with a fast moving dev team
